Transaction e7490639cf310f20f72eba48ded0d55e744e5c13b6c0a77b1a0b3b66ebb8a376

1 Input
2 Outputs
  • e7490639cf310f20f72eba48ded0d55e744e5c13b6c0a77b1a0b3b66ebb8a376:0
  • value  16763300
    address  34ZrTE18Fg7xo3PBrdnEEM4LgHViNQRKKd
  • e7490639cf310f20f72eba48ded0d55e744e5c13b6c0a77b1a0b3b66ebb8a376:1
  • value  509461016
    address  bc1q0l3jk7t4syvhkpxesfywh89hd8m8pz58e3fmln